Rescue Report

Swiftwater Rescue / Motor Vehicle Accident

May 25, 2007
Merced River, Crane Creek Confluence - El Portal

Cries for help were heard at 10:30pm from the Merced River near the Crane Creek confluence (Highway 140, south of Yosemite View Lodge). A vehicle was partially submerged in swift moving water with one occupant stranded on top of the vehicle. Units from Yosemite National Park, Mariposa County Sheriff, and the California Highway Patrol responded. The swiftwater team was able to use a rescuer with a tethered rescue board to safely bring the driver of the vehicle to shore. The vehicle sank shortly after the subject was extricated.
